PART 1GENERAL
Interpretation2
In these Regulations, unless the context otherwise requires—
“appeal panel” means an appeal panel constituted under Part 3;
“appellant” means a person who brings an appeal to an appeal panel under Part 2;
“applicant” means an individual who applies for civil legal services;
“civil legal services” has the meaning given by Article 10 of the Order;
“decision notice” has the meaning given by regulation 28;
“the Department” means the Department of Justice;
“the Director” means the Director of Legal Aid Casework designated by the Department under section 2 of the Legal Aid and Coroners’ Courts Act (Northern Ireland) 20142;
“list” means a list of persons appointed by the Department under regulation 12 or 13;
“the Order” means the Access to Justice (Northern Ireland) Order 2003;
“other member” means a person appointed by the Department to the list of persons to act as other members of the appeal panels under regulation 13;
“out of jurisdiction appeal” means an appeal brought against a decision prescribed in regulation 5 and the Schedule as a decision against which no appeal lies;
“presiding member” means a person appointed by the Department to the list of persons to act as presiding members of the appeal panels under regulation 12;
“relevant decision” means a Director’s decision as referred to in regulation 4.
